Football Income Makes SEC the Richest Conference
A big jump in football TV income helped the Southeastern Conference take in more than million last year to maintain its position as the richest college sports league. The SEC's take from regular-season football games increased 38 percent to million during the tax year that ended Aug. 31, according to Internal Revenue Service records reviewed by The Associated Press. With million in assets and no liabilities, the SEC's total revenues for the year were .8 million - well ahead of the second-place Big 12 Conference, which reported .6 million in revenues, million in assets and ,833 in liabilities.
